Abstract

Emerging and re-emerging vector-borne diseases such as chikungunya and dengue and associated Aedes vectors are expanding their historical ranges; thus, there is a need for the development of novel insecticides for use in vector control programs. The mosquito toxicity of a novel insecticide and repellent consisting of mediumchain carbon fatty acids (C8910) was examined. Determination of LC50 and LC90 was made against colonyreared Aedes aegypti (L.) and Aedes albopictus (Skuse) using probit analysis on mortality data generated by Centers for Disease Control and Prevention bottle bioassays. Six different concentrations of C8910 + silicone oil yielded an LC50 of 160.3 µg a.i/bottle (147.6–182.7) and LC90 of 282.8 (233.2–394.2) in Ae. aegypti; five concentrations yielded an LC50 of 125.4 (116.1–137.6) and LC90 of 192.5 (165.0–278.9) in Ae. albopictus. Further development of C8910 and similar compounds could provide vector control specialists novel insecticides for controlling insect disease vectors.
